I just built an s13 SR for 500whp for pro-am. Next season looking at hitting 550whp with response with different turbo setup. Right now, Complete tomei valvetrain with ferrea oversized valves, all the headwork to support it, twin scroll 3076 setup, blended and port matched intake and exhaust manifolds, CP 87mm 9:1 comp, eagle rods, cosworth, acl, arp everywhere.......

KA advantages
-no rocker arms
-high flowing head (flows more like a VE head, and with headwork even more)
-super low starting costs (you can score KAs for free sometimes.. lolll literally)

SR advantages
-more options for aftermarket support
-out of the box reliability and performance
-stock SR can push out as much as the tranny can reliably. perfect. Slap on fuel and bigger turbo tune it and get some seat time

If you're going all out build I'd say KA is way to go. It's a little heavier than an SR, buuuut I think it's worth the few lbs lol.

KA needs:
-rotating assembly balanced
-cheezy rods replaced
-forced induction friendly pistons (not comrpession ratio, ring land to piston face distance)
-bigger head studs lol (for 700whp etc) (rb26 ones fit with machining from what I've seen)
